About the MHCC

Established in September of 1989, The Michigan Hispanic Chamber of Commerce is a non-profit business association governed by a 30-member Board of Directors that embodies the business diversity of its membership.  They are the leading gateway to the state’s 11,000 Hispanic businesses and over 400,000 Latino consumers. MHCC serves as an activist for jobs and economic development by sponsoring participation in supplier diversity development programs and international trade with Mexico and other Latin American countries. 

MHCC's membership mirrors the assortment of Hispanic business enterprises in the state.  Their member firms have steadily been ranked among the Top Hispanic-owned firms both regionally and nationally.

About Camilo Suero

Camilo Suero is now the Executive Director of MHCC and is responsible for representing the interests of the 11,000 Hispanic owned business in Michigan and management of day-to-day Chamber operations.  Gary Gonzalez, Chairman of the MHCC Board of Directors, has said that he “brings the right combination of corporate supply chain experience and a background in leading a professional business association as immediate past President of the MHCC Board of Directors”. 

Before linking up with the Michigan Hispanic Chamber of Commerce, Suero finished a 17 year career in Logistics and Supply Chain Management which was spread between Ryder Logistics and Ford Motor Company.  While at Ford, he assisted new and concerned suppliers putting into effect guidelines and recovery actions that were able to make business with OEMs successful.  

Suero is well known in the local Hispanic community as having served as President of the Detroit Chapter of the National Society of Hispanic MBA’s while also serving as a member on the executive board of Ford Hispanic Network.  He obtains a Masters in Business Administration from Wayne State University, Detroit, and a B.S. in Business Administration from UNIBE, Santo Domingo, Dominican Republic.
